			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>Alyn Loyd &#8211; Associate Pastor</h2>
<p>Serving as associate pastor since 1998. Alyn Loyd, and his wife, Billie, moved from London England to Huntington Beach to serve the Lord at Calvary Chapel Huntington Beach.</p>
<p>Pastor Alyn first put his trust in Jesus back in 1975 after reading a Gospel of John. It was given to him by some genuinely loving believers he &#8220;accidentally&#8221; encountered at their home fellowship. Sitting on a break, one day at work at the old Sheraton in HB on PCH, he read that gospel and the end of the booklet had a question, asking, &#8220;Having read this Gospel of John, is there any reason to not ask Jesus to be your Lord * Savior?&#8221; &#8220;no&#8221;, to that question, and &#8220;yes&#8221; to Jesus, is what followed. It was there on that job he also met his wife-to-be, Billie.</p>
<p>They wed in 1977, attended Calvary Chapel Bible College in Twin Peaks in 1980, and began a family of three girls in 1981. Pastor Alyn co-led a thriving home fellowship in HB then, as well as the weekly prayer meeting at Calvary Chapel HB, and God confirmed the call to ministry.</p>
<p>The family moved, to north San Diego County in 1984, and plugged into Calvary Chapel Vista. There Alyn eventually served as a Sunday School teacher, usher, board member and later as assistant pastor, while also running a small business. </p>
<p>Once again the family moved in 1997. This time to help with a new church planted in London, England, as well as lay the groundwork for another church plant in Harrogate (in the north of England). While serving in the UK, Alyn providentially met Refuge&#8217;s Senior Pastor, Bill Welsh, who was in the UK for just a couple days.</p>
<p>A year later, the family was back to Huntington Beach, and Pastor Alyn became the Associate Pastor of Refuge. It was during the return to the U.S. that Pastor Alyn earned his Master&#8217;s degree in Pastoral Ministry. Currently, he leads Man2Man (Refuge Men&#8217;s Ministry), counsels, serves as the administrator and as Pastor Bill&#8217;s right hand man.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Bill Welsh, and his wife, Joy, began serving the Lord at Calvary Chapel Huntington Beach in 1997. It was at that time Bill was asked to take the Senior Pastor position. They moved their family to Huntington Beach in June of 1997. They continue to serve the Lord in that capacity today. Joy is leading the women&#8217;s ministry, Heart 2 Heart.</p>
<p>Complete Bio: </p>
<p>1952</p>
<p>Born in Cincinnati, Ohio. One brother and three sisters. Raised in a Roman Catholic family. Mother and Father divorced in 1963.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1967</p>
<p> Bill&#8217;s mother moved with all five children to Long Beach, California in September.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1970</p>
<p>Bill received Jesus Christ as His Lord and Savior at &#8220;Body and Soul&#8221; a &#8220;Jesus Meeting&#8221; in Long Beach during the &#8220;Jesus Movement&#8221;. He became a part of the body at Calvary Chapel of Costa Mesa and continued to serve there teaching Sunday School and leading worship for the children&#8217;s ministry and Jr. High school as well as working with the building of the facility (as a &#8220;very unskilled&#8221; laborer)</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1971</p>
<p>Bill began to serve at &#8220;The House of Zaccaeus&#8221; a Christian coffee house in Long Beach where he met his future bride, Joy who was also a part of the volunteer staff.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>1973</p>
<p>Bill moved to Sky Valley, California to serve on staff at the Sky Valley Desert Retreat center (near Palm Springs) to complete his alternate service as a &#8220;conscientious objector&#8221; during the Viet Nam war. June 3rd of 1973 Bill and Joy were married in Long Beach California. Their four children (Bethany, Shannon, Jeremy and Starlin) were born in Palm Springs, California.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1978</p>
<p>Bill began to preach weekly at Indio Hills Community Church, in Indio Hills, California (also known as Happy Valley &#8211; true story). Starting as a guest speaker, Bill was invited to consider taking the leadership of the church. Bill &amp; Joy served that body for about 3 years while also serving in many capacities at the Church in Sky Valley.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1981</p>
<p>Bill and Joy began a home Bible study in Desert Hot Springs, CA, which turned into Calvary Chapel of Desert Hot Springs, California. They served for about 7 years.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>1987</p>
<p>Bill &amp; Joy along with their son Jeremy took their first trip to Australia, preaching in many churches and doing evangelistic concerts in Melbourne and Sydney. They took outreach teams there each summer from 1987-1990.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>1991</p>
<p>In June of 1991, Bill &amp; Joy and their children moved to Melbourne, Australia to establish the work of Calvary Chapel Melbourne. They lived there for three and a half years until their temporary residence visas ran expired.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>1994</p>
<p>In December of 1994, Bill accepted an invitation from Skp Heitzig to join the staff of Calvary Chapel of Albuguerque. The Welsh family moved to Albuguerque and Bill took on the leadership of School of Ministry and the Missions department at Calvary Chapel of Albuguerque, New Mexico. </p>
<p> </p>
<p>1997</p>
<p>Bill was asked to take the Senior Pastor position at Calvary Chapel of Huntington Beach, California. The family moved to Huntington Beach in June of 1997 and continues to serve the Lord in that capacity. Joy is leading the women&#8217;s ministry.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="color: #ff6600;">Refuge is a Person</span>… the God who reveals Himself as “Father”</p>
<p>He is the father and friend we have all been looking for and He invites us to come to Him through Jesus Christ and to bring all our joys and pains, praises and questions, faith and doubts.</p>
<p><span style="color: #ff6600;">Refuge is People.</span>.. followers of Jesus Christ are called to be a people of refuge in a dangerous world.</p>
<p><span style="color: #ff6600;">Refuge is a place</span>&#8230; any place becomes a refuge if God&#8217;s people are found doing God&#8217;s buiness there.</p>
<p>Refuge has been formed as a fellowship of believers in the Lordship of Jesus Christ. Our supreme desire is to know Christ and be conformed into his image by the power of the Holy Spirit. We are not a denominational church, nor are we opposed to denominations as such, only their overemphasis of the doctrinal differeneces that have led to the division of the body of Christ.</p>

<p style="text-align: center;"><strong><em>Psalm 13</em></strong></p>
<p style="text-align: center;">Have you ever felt as if your prayers were just bouncing off the ceiling?</p>
<p style="text-align: center;">Read Psalm 13, I’ll wait here till you get back…</p>
<p>Wow, your not alone are you? David didn’t just paint on a happy face and pretend like everything was OK when his life was in turmoil. David was honest about his feelings, yet they did not rule his life, govern his actions or drive him into hopeless depression. Instead they drove him to the throne of God. He didn’t instruct God how to fix the problem, his request was for God to consider his trial, hear his prayer and give him understanding. In the end the thing that changed was David’s perspective, from earthly to heavenly. David states, in spite of the way I feel and what I’m going through, <strong>“I have trusted in Your mercy; My heart shall rejoice in Your salvation. I will sing to the Lord, because He has dealt bountifully with me.”</strong></p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p>Can I see in my own life, that when I have trusted God through trials, He has dealt bountifully with me? Do I understand looking back that He is working his eternal purpose in my life? Will I trust that He has my best interest at heart? Can I say, “Therefore we do not lose heart. Even though our outward man is perishing, yet the inward man is being renewed day by day. For our light affliction, which is but for a moment, is working for us a far more exceeding and external weight of glory,” (2 Cor. 16-17)</p>
